Airborne 05.05.15: UAV Vandalism, Ryanair Ripped Off, B-1 Upgrades

Also: United CEO Pay Raise, Aero-Calendar, Space Video Game, Frequent Flier Letdowns, Billion Dollar Cargo Suit, Honeywell/737MAX

Indiscriminate use of small UAVs has posed a problem, but now we have a case of a UAV being intentionally used to commit vandalism.

A graffitti lawbreaker has attached a spray-paint can to a DJI Phantom UAV to vandalize a huge billboard in New York City ... thought to be the first time an unmanned aircraft has been used for such a public display of vandalism. Running an airline can be challenging, but now Ryanair confirms an attack on their bank account. It’s reported that a Chinese bank found a way to remove nearly $5 million from an account Ryanair uses to buy fuel for its aircraft. The Boeing B-1B Lancer celebrates its 30th anniversary with the U.S. Air Force which marks one of many milestones in a legacy that will continue long into the future as Boeing’s B-1 team ushers the supersonic bomber into the digital age with new upgrades.
